Latest Patents

Yuyao Chen holds a patent for "Diffractive axilenses and uses thereof." This patent describes an optical element that includes a substrate and a pattern. The substrate features a top surface and a bottom surface, with the pattern provided on the top surface. The pattern consists of multiple levels, ensuring that its thickness is less than a design wavelength. This configuration allows the pattern to focus incident radiation, received at either the top or bottom surface of the substrate, at one or more prescribed focal locations on a detection plane. Notably, the prescribed focal locations on the detection plane change in proportion to the wavelength of the incident radiation. When the incident radiation includes multiple wavelengths, the detection plane acts as an achromatic focal plane.
